Abstract

This study explores the development of a character-building model that integrates the Merdeka Curriculum and School-Driven Program to foster religious and social care values among high school students in Banda Aceh. Using a qualitative approach, data was collected through observations, in-depth interviews, and documentation analysis, involving school principals, teachers, students, and community members from four high schools in Banda Aceh. Triangulation of sources and techniques ensured data validity. The findings show that each school employs unique character-building strategies aligned with its vision and mission. The study emphasizes the importance of proactive school leadership, teacher engagement, and community collaboration in successful character education. To address challenges such as cultural differences, student readiness, and resource limitations, the Busi (Islamic School Culture) model was developed. This model integrates religious values and social activities, enhancing students discipline, empathy, and social skills. The implementation of the Busi model led to significant improvements in students moral and social development. The study underscores the need for integrating religious and social values into the curriculum and fostering collaboration between schools, families, and communities to achieve holistic character education.

Abstract

The use of frameworks in research is important, because with it the research to be carried out gets the right direction and a clear position. However, many studies do not use the framework in their implementation or use it but not in depth. This article aims to analyze the role, relevance, and development of frameworks in the cross-disciplinary scientific literature. The framework is understood as a conceptual foundation that connects theories, methodologies, and findings so as to maintain research coherence. This study uses a literature study design by examining articles from accredited national and international journals. Data were collected through the search of various academic databases and analyzed using a thematic approach to identify patterns of conceptualization, relevance, and forms of adaptation of frameworks in various disciplines. The results of the study show that the framework functions strategically in strengthening theoretical foundations, sharpening the identification of research gaps, and guiding the design of contextual and innovative research models. This study confirms that the development of a framework that is adaptive to social, cultural, and disciplinary contexts is key to maintaining relevance and increasing scientific contribution in the midst of the dynamics of knowledge development.
